Introduction: With an emphasis on both cross-border services and local access, Hong Kong VPS with a 4-core 4G configuration is gradually becoming a popular choice for small and medium-sized enterprises. This article analyzes the advantages of this configuration from multiple perspectives, helping enterprises balance performance, cost, and compliance requirements when deploying it.
Cost and Value for Money Analysis
Small and medium-sized enterprises usually have limited budgets, and Hong Kong VPS with 4 cores and 4GB offers a balanced solution in terms of processing power and memory. This configuration can meet common needs such as Web, API, and database caching, avoiding excessive investment in physical servers while enabling on-demand scaling to improve overall cost-effectiveness.
Network latency and geographical advantages
As a network hub in the Asia-Pacific region, Hong Kong offers low and stable latency when connecting the Chinese mainland to international nodes. For applications targeting users in Hong Kong, the Chinese mainland, or Southeast Asia, having a VPS in Hong Kong helps reduce response times, improve the user experience, and speed up page loading.
Resource stability and performance assurance
A 4-core CPU with 4GB of memory provides sufficient computing and concurrency capabilities for most small to medium-sized businesses. This configuration can maintain stable performance during peak times, reducing service disruptions caused by insufficient resources. It is suitable for websites with moderate traffic and lightweight applications.
Compliance and Facilitation of Cross-Border Access
Hong Kong has a clear legal framework for data transmission and regulation, facilitating data exchange with international clients or partners on the mainland. Choosing a Hong Kong VPS helps meet specific regional compliance requirements, while also facilitating cross-border business operations and collaboration.
Ease of deployment and maintenance
VPS typically provides features such as images, automated deployment, and one-click reinstallation, simplifying the process of going live and managing operations. For small and medium-sized enterprises with limited manpower, the standard 4-core 4GB configuration facilitates quick deployment, monitoring, and troubleshooting, reducing operational complexity.
Scalability and flexibility to handle growth
Business growth or promotional periods can lead to a surge in traffic, and Hong Kong VPSs typically support flexible vertical or horizontal scaling. Starting with 4 cores and 4GB makes it easy to upgrade or add instances as needed later, enabling flexible allocation of resources without affecting daily operations.
Security, backup, and reliability considerations
When choosing a VPS, small and medium-sized enterprises should pay attention to snapshot backups, image strategies, and network security capabilities. The snapshot and backup features provided by Hong Kong VPS can reduce the risk of data loss, while firewall and access control capabilities enhance the overall reliability of the service.
Examples of applicable scenarios
Hong Kong VPS with 4 cores and 4GB is suitable for small to medium-sized e-commerce sites, corporate websites, SaaS front-end services, and small-scale API backends. For projects that seek low latency, cross-border access, and controllable costs, this configuration often meets the needs for business launch and stable operation.
Summary and Recommendations
Summary: Hong Kong VPS With its cost-effectiveness, network advantages, stable performance, and ease of maintenance, the 4-core 4GB configuration has become a common choice for deployment in small and medium-sized enterprises. It is recommended that companies consider their business traffic, compliance requirements, and long-term expansion plans when selecting solutions. They should also evaluate backup and security strategies to ensure that the deployment is both cost-effective and robust.
